Transaction 23429e1f750b29605749d82a14e7739d81f84fa0d78522ac995cb5d641ce8a35

5 Input
2 Outputs
  • 23429e1f750b29605749d82a14e7739d81f84fa0d78522ac995cb5d641ce8a35:0
  • value  946858
    address  3DTjckvW8mEVFgE8sHmjwicmuUXKYdkT8K
  • 23429e1f750b29605749d82a14e7739d81f84fa0d78522ac995cb5d641ce8a35:1
  • value  192241587
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s